Casting info--cavity

September 05, 2024
1.Casting info
name:cavity
requirements:air tightness
casting process: 
Die Casting machine tonnage:100T
punch dia(mm):70
alloy material: ADC12
filling weigh(g)t:1362
casting weight (g):1006
casting size(mm): 332*140*115.5
average wall thickness(mm):3.5
high velocity m/s:4.5
dry injection stroke(mm):550
high velocity switching position(mm):310
Inner gate section area mm²:167
2.Casting problem
products cavity core offset one side 1mm, cold lap is serious on the tail surface  
3.Casting picture
Casting picture
4. casting analysis
Different wall thickness problem: when two core-pulling are not fixed when the mold is closed, and the aluminum water flows at high speed, causing pressure on the long core-pulling. When the erosion pressure is greater than the long core-pulling , the core-pulling  will swing and shift to one side.
pic 3 defects position(core is deviated on gate position,cold lap on the tail end)pic 4 core-pulling hit diagram
Cold lap issue: 
Main runner gate section area too small.(original design 167 mm²)
When design main runner,the distance from the tail to main runner was not considered(potential failure).
when normal die casting,aluminium liquid flows to the end, temperature is dropped rapidly.It is hard to form.
5.improving measures
1. Add a certain position at the two core pulling points to ensure concentricity and prevent core deviation. As shown in the picture below:
2. ① main runner gate section area is  from 167 mm² increased to  238.56 mm². 
② add aided gate, build a bridge on the middle of products,which helps to facilitate the rapid flow of  aluminum liquid, reduce the time to reach the tail, in order to improve the molding effect, as shown in the following pictures:
Pic8 Add assistant runner diagram
7. Tips
For core shift
1.die-casting design should pay attention to the the wall thickness of the core on both sides ,which should be as uniform as possible, to prevent the core bending during contraction; At the same time, attention should be paid to the length and diameter of the core, and the slender core is easier to bend.
2. In the design of the gating system, attention should be paid to avoiding direct impact on the core as far as possible, and the mold structure should be inserted and fixed.
